STONE COUNTERTOP FABRICATION

  • General: Fabricate stone countertops in sizes and shapes required to comply with requirements indicated, including details on Drawings and approved Shop Drawings.

    1. Granite: Comply with recommendations.

    2. Marble: Comply with recommendations. 

  • Thickness: Provide thickness as indicated for the following:

    1. Countertop

    2. Back and End Splashes

    3. Thresholds: Fabricate to size and profile as indicated or required to provide transition between adjacent floor finishes.

    4. Edge Detail: Countertops: As shown on Drawings 

    5. Thresholds: Bevel edges of thresholds or as indicated. 

    6. Seams: Fabricate countertops without seams. If seams are required, fabricate sections indicated for joining in field, with seams as follows:
      1Bonded Seams: 1/32 inch or less in width.

    7. Cutouts and Holes for Lavatories, Sinks, and Fittings:

    8. Undercounter Lavatories: Make cutouts for undercounter lavatories in shop using
      template or pattern furnished by lavatory manufacturer. Form cutouts to smooth, even curves with edges at right angles to top. Ease juncture of cutout edges with tops, and finish edges to match tops.

    9. Fittings: Drill countertops in shop for plumbing fittings, undercounter soap dispensers, and similar items.
